#3bc584 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3bc584 is composed of 23.1% red, 77.3%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 33%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 151.7 degrees, a saturation of 54.3% and a lightness of 50.2%. #3bc584 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#008b09.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#3bc584 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3bc584 has RGB values of R:59, G:197,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 3917188.
